We all know that the most effective way to add testosterone to your body is through an injection. Commonly administrated with a shot to the glutes, shoulders, or other region, this testosterone was suspended in oil, drawn into a syringe, and plunged deep into the muscle group. The testosterone was then absorbed into the bloodstream and used by the body.

Another way to add testosterone to the body is through the use of a patch. Its effectiveness is argued, and it’s mainly used for low dose hormone replacement therapy. Elite bodybuilders wouldn’t be aided much by the small doses a patch delivers.

Oral testosterone has never been considered effective for boosting testosterone levels. The liver is very efficient at inactivating testosterone quickly when it is taken orally. Other anabolic steroids taken orally, such as Dianabol, lacked the strength and performance ability of testosterone, and have always been considered “default” choices should testosterone not be available (or useful agents to be stacked with the common testosterone base). Athletes didn’t have a way to orally ingest testosterone effectively. Until now.

Andriol Testocaps, or testosterone Undeconoate, is an oral steroid, which contains testosterone. It is designed to be absorbed by the lymphatic system receptors in the intestine, which helps the agent to avoid the liver entirely. Since there isn’t the breakdown that occurs with other oral steroids in the liver, the body receives a steady dose of testosterone for 4-6 hours. Additionally, there is minimal conversion to estrogen thanks to its short life in the body. This means that side effects such as Gynecomastia and excessive bloating don’t appear as much as with testosterone or other oral anabolic steroids.
